lexA
LexA repressor; Represses a number of genes involved in the response to DNA damage (SOS response), including recA and lexA. In the presence of single-stranded DNA, recA interacts with lexA causing an autocatalytic cleavage which disrupts the DNA-binding part of lexA, leading to derepression of the SOS regulon and eventually DNA repair (By similarity) (275 aa)
(Acidothermus cellulolyticus)
